Associated space launch
Military communications satellites
COSMOS 1053 was lifted into orbit during the mission ‘Kosmos-3M | Strela-1M 161-168’, on board a Kosmos-3M space rocket.
The launch took place on Dec. 5, 1978, 6:12 p.m. from 132/2.
